JUSTICE JYOTI SARAN ORAL JUDGMENT Date: 06-04-2017 Heard learned counsel for the parties.
The legal issue raised cannot be contested for no one can be sent on deputation outside his/her cadre without his/her consent. In the present case admittedly, the petitioners who are Grade- A nurses posted in the Patna Medical College and Hospital are being sent on deputation as 'Nursing Tutor' in their own pay scale, to different ANM/ GNM Training Centres across the State. It is taking note of the situation that a Bench of this Court vide order passed on 13.1.2016 while requiring an answer from the State, stayed the operation of the order of deputation impugned at Annexure-1 dated 5.12.2015 as well as the relieving order dated 18.12.2015 at Annexure-2.
Although the legal position in this regard is well settled but for the sake of convenience ready reference is made to the judgment of
Patna High Court CWJC No.375 of 2016 dt.06-04-2017 3/3 the Supreme Court reported in (1997) 8 SCC 372 (State of Punjab and Ors. vs. Inder Singh and Ors. ) and (1999) 4 SCC 659 (Umapati Choudhary vs. State of Bihar Anr.).
For the reasons discussed and the law settled in the judgment referred to above, the deputation order 5.12.2015 impugned at Annexure-1 along with relieving order dated 18.12.2015 impugned at Annexure-2 are quashed and set aside.
The writ petitions are allowed.
